It has been a privilege to know John Steer and his wonderful wife Donna. John has served Christ and his fellow Veterans, above and beyond the call, for many years now. There aren't too many who would do what John has so selflessly done. I am very thankful and feel blessed to have an American hero like John Steer traveling amongst us and working to save the lost. Go Herd! I also warms my heart to know that a hero of mine has such a great woman watching his back. This is a fantastic book that chronicles the change in the heart of a soldier that occured on a hill in Vietnam, a hill he should never have come off of alive.
